Sample Talks (4)

Viva La Revolution! 5 Cs That Will Revolutionise Your Ability To Recruit, Engage and Retain Staff in Today's Social Age

Employee engagement has reached an all-time low, according to many studies. We help you join the revolution by using the 5 Cs to recruit, engage and retain the right staff: Hire Correctly, Classify and manage appropriately, Compensate fairly, Use Currencies of Choice to truly engage your workforce, Communicate more effectively using the Manager’s Mind Map ©. A fresh, easy to apply framework with several practical tools you can apply immediately.

Licence To Hire

This half day workshop focuses managers on the importance of making a good hire, the cost of a bad one, and helps them to truly understand the cost of a disengaged workforce and how this might be affecting their own team’s productivity. This two-part workshop (delivered separately or together) provides your managers with a tangible process, framework and several practical tools to ensure that each hire is the best hire it can be.

Mind Reading for Managers

Most employee engagement issues can be solved through better communication between managers and staff. Our Manager’s Mind Map © not only demystifies your employee’s drivers and motivations, it also helps you have better conversations around job performance and career development – consistently shown to be in the top 3 factors staff consider when deciding to stay or leave.
